Michael t. Klare is a professor of peace and world security studies at hampshire college and the defense correspondent of the nation. He is the author, most recently, of the race for what’s left.

From columbia … Michael klare is the author of fourteen books, including: Resource wars (2001); Blood and oil (2004); Rising powers, shrinking planet (2008); And the race for what’s left (2012).
